The Real Estate Servicing Manager is responsible for management and supervision for the servicing functions covering secondary market serviced loans and inter-related processes for consumer portfolio loans.
Responsibilities include:
Mortgage Servicing Leadership and Oversight
The primary responsibility of this position will be the ongoing supervision and management of secondary market servicing operations.
As the lead member of the secondary market servicing team at Stockman Bank, this position will be required to oversee all servicing functions. This includes:
Managing the servicing staff
Monitoring departmental performance
Developing and maintaining departmental servicing procedures
Assessing productivity
Identifying areas for improvement
Maintaining sufficient internal control and compliance posture
Property tax, hazard and flood insurance monitoring and payment functions
Reporting on bank servicing to appropriate management team member(s)
Regulatory
Keep up to date on regulation and handbook changes establish and update procedures to address regulatory requirements with respect to servicing including collections and loss mitigation.
Provide appropriate and timely responses to compliance and regulatory audits.
Provide leadership and training for staff on processes and procedures to achieve efficiencies and improvement.
Other Critical Responsibilities
Coordinate Mortgage Servicing Operations with other bank functions. Supervise the relationships between Mortgage Servicing Operations and the other departments of the bank including Operations, Compliance, Technology, Branch Management, and Lending.
